Police Psychologist to Mystery Writer
Mar. 06, 2018
Dr. Ellen Kirschman, clinical psychologist and consultant, has been working with law enforcement agencies for over 20 years. She has written extensively about the law enforcement culture and is sought after as a speaker and seminar leader. Dr. Kirschman has been an invited guest at the FBI academy and is a member of the Psychology Section of the International Association of Chiefs of Police. She resides in Redwood City, California

Programs and Initiatives concerning Earthquake Preparedness
Apr. 03, 2018
Bob
Glenn Pomeroy, Chief Executive Officer, California Earthquake Authority Glenn Pomeroy has been the CEO of the not-for-profit CEA—the largest earthquake insurance provider in the United States, and one of the largest in the world—since 2008. Under Glenn’s leadership, CEA has been able to significantly lower its rates and dramatically increase its coverage options—increasing the number of homes protected by over 230,000. Glenn is originally from North Dakota, where he previously served his native state as a member of the state legislature (he was first elected at age 22), county prosecutor and North Dakota Insurance Commissioner. He was selected by his peers from around the country to serve as President of the National Association of Insurance Commissioners. He later worked in the private reinsurance industry in Kansas City. As part of CEA's strategic plan to Educate, Mitigate and Insure, Glenn has been crisscrossing the state to spread the news about the new, affordable options now available from CEA. |
